# | Name | Sym | Year Disc. | Discoverer |
1 | Hydrogen | H | 1776 | Henry Cavendish, named by LaVoisier in 1783 |
2 | Helium | He | 1895 | P. T. Cleve / N. A. Langlet |
3 | Lithium | Li | 1817 | Johan August Arfwedson |
4 | Beryllium | Be | 1797 | Louis-Nicolas Vauquelin |
5 | Boron | B | 1808 | Sir Humphry Davy/Joseph Louis Gay-Lussac/Louis Jacques Thénard |
6 | Carbon | C | ancient | ? |
7 | Nitrogen | N | 1772 | Daniel Rutherford |
8 | Oxygen | O | 1774 | Joseph Priestly |
9 | Fluorine | F | 1886 | Henri Moissan |
10 | Neon | Ne | 1898 | Sir William Ramsay/Morris W. Travers |
11 | Sodium | Na | 1807 | Sir Humphry Davy |
12 | Magnesium | Mg | 1755 | Sir Humphry Davy |
13 | Aluminum | Al | 1825 | Hans Christian Ørsted/Friedrich Wöhler |
14 | Silicon | Si | 1824 | Jöns Jacob Berzelius |
15 | Phosphorus | P | 1669 | Hennig Brand |
16 | Sulfur | S | ancient | ? |
17 | Chlorine | Cl | 1774 | Carl Wilhelm Scheele |
18 | Argon | Ar | 1894 | Lord Rayleigh/Sir William Ramsay |
19 | Potassium | K | 1807 | Sir Humphry Davy |
20 | Calcium | Ca | 1808 | Sir Humphry Davy |
21 | Scandium | Sc | 1879 | Lars Fredrik Nilson |
22 | Titanium | Ti | 1791 | William Gregor |
23 | Vanadium | V | 1830 | Andrés Manuel del Río |
24 | Chromium | Cr | 1797 | Louis-Nicolas Vauquelin |
25 | Manganese | Mn | 1774 | Johan Gottlieb Gahn |
26 | Iron | Fe | ancient | ? |
27 | Cobalt | Co | 1735 | Georg Brandt |
28 | Nickel | Ni | 1751 | Baron Axel Fredrik Cronstedt |
29 | Copper | Cu | ancient | ? |
30 | Zinc | Zn | ancient | ? |
31 | Gallium | Ga | 1875 | Paul Emile Lecoq de Boisbaudran |
32 | Germanium | Ge | 1886 | Clemens Alexander Winkler |
33 | Arsenic | As | ancient | ? |
34 | Selenium | Se | 1817 | Jöns Jakob Berzelius/Johan Gottlieb Gahn |
35 | Bromine | Br | 1826 | Carl Jacob Löwig/Antoine Balard |
36 | Krypton | Kr | 1898 | Sir William Ramsay/Morris W. Travers |
37 | Rubidium | Ru | 1861 | Robert Bunsen/Gustav Kirchhoff |
38 | Strontium | Sr | 1790 | Sir Humphry Davy |
39 | Yttrium | Y / Yt | 1794 | Johan Gadolin |
40 | Zirconium | Zr | 1789 | Martin Heinrich Klaproth |
41 | Niobium | Nb | 1801 | Charles Hatchett |
42 | Molybdenum | Mo | 1781 | Peter Jacob Hjelm |
43 | Technetium | Tc | 1937 | Carlo Perrier/Emilio Segrè |
44 | Ruthenium | Ru | 1844 | Karl Ernst Claus |
45 | Rhodium | Rh | 1803 | William Hyde Wollaston |
46 | Palladium | Pd | 1803 | William Hyde Wollaston |
47 | Silver | Ag | ancient | ? |
48 | Cadmium | Cd | 1817 | Friedrich Stromeyer/Karl Samuel Leberecht Hermann |
49 | Indium | In | 1863 | Ferdinand Reich and Hieronymous Theodor Richter |
50 | Tin | Sn | ancient | ? |
51 | Antimony | Sb | ancient | ? |
52 | Tellurium | Te | 1783 | Franz-Joseph Müller von Reichenstein/Pál Kitaibel |
53 | Iodine | I | 1811 | Bernard Courtois |
54 | Xenon | Xe | 1898 | Sir William Ramsay/Morris W. Travers |
55 | Cesium | Cs | 1860 | Robert Bunsen/Gustav Kirchhoff |
56 | Barium | Ba | 1808 | Sir Humphry Davy |
57 | Lanthanum | La | 1839 | Carl Gustaf Mosander |
58 | Cerium | Ce | 1803 | Jöns Jakob Berzelius/Wilhelm Hisinger/Martin Heinrich Klaproth |
59 | Praseodymium | Pr | 1885 | Carl Auer von Welsbach |
60 | Neodymium | Nd | 1885 | Carl Auer von Welsbach |
61 | Promethium | Pm | 1945 | Jacob A. Marinsky, Lawrence E. Glendenin and Charles D. Coryell |
62 | Samarium | Sm | 1879 | Paul Émile Lecoq de Boisbaudran |
63 | Europium | Eu | 1901 | Eugène-Anatole Demarçay |
64 | Gadolinium | Gd | 1880 | Jean Charles Galissard de Marignac |
65 | Terbium | Tb | 1843 | Carl Gustaf Mosander |
66 | Dysprosium | Dy | 1886 | Paul Émile Lecoq de Boisbaudran |
67 | Holmium | Ho | 1878 | Jacques-Louis Soret/Marc Delafontaine |
68 | Erbium | Er | 1842 | Carl Gustaf Mosander |
69 | Thulium | Tm | 1879 | Per Teodor Cleve |
70 | Ytterbium | Yb | 1878 | Jean Charles Galissard de Marignac |
71 | Lutetium | Lu | 1907 | Georges Urbain/Baron Carl Auer von Welsbach/Charles James |
72 | Hafnium | Hf | 1923 | Coster and Hevesy |
73 | Tantalum | Ta | 1802 | Anders Gustaf Ekenberg |
74 | Tungsten | W | 1783 | Juan José and Fausto Elhuyar |
75 | Rhenium | Re | 1925 | Walter Noddack, Ida Tacke and Otto Berg |
76 | Osmium | Os | 1803 | Smithson Tennant/William Hyde Wollaston |
77 | Iridium | Ir | 1803 | Smithson Tennant/William Hyde Wollaston |
78 | Platinum | Pt | 1735 | Antonio de Ulloa |
79 | Gold | Au | ancient | ? |
80 | Mercury | Hg | ancient | ? |
81 | Thallium | Tl | 1861 | Sir William Crookes |
82 | Lead | Pb | ancient | ? |
83 | Bismuth | Bi | ancient | ? |
84 | Polonium | Po | 1898 | Marie Curie |
85 | Astatine | At | 1940 | Dale Corson |
86 | Radon | Rn | 1900 | Friedrich Ernst Dorn |
87 | Francium | Fr | 1939 | Marguerite Perey |
88 | Radium | Ra | 1898 | Marie and Pierre Curie |
89 | Actinium | Ac | 1899 | Andre Debierne |
90 | Thorium | Th | 1829 | Jöns Berzelius |
91 | Protactinium | Pa | 1913 | Otto Hahn, Lise Meitner, Frederick Soddy, John Cranston |
92 | Uranium | U | 1789 | Martin Heinrich Klaproth |
